(BY ELECTRIC TELEGRAPH.)

(From Grremllt's Telegram Company, Beuier's Agents.)

Dtjnedin, May 31, 5 p.m. Mr. Oargill announced resignation of the Government this afternoon. The House then adjourned. A meeting of twenty-eight members, supposed to hold similar opinions 'with Mr. Reid, was held immediately after the House adjourned. >, „ Probable new Executive, Reid Cutten, Menzies, Bathgate, Bastings, and Swap" ter.
